On the other hand, hold-down springs ensure that the brake shoes remain securely in place during operation. They prevent the shoes from moving excessively, thereby promoting even wear and optimal contact with the brake drum. If these springs fail or weaken, it can lead to a variety of issues, such as decreased braking efficiency, increased stopping distances, and uneven wear on the brake shoes.

when do brake drums need to be replacedThe adjuster mechanism is responsible for compensating for the wear of the brake shoes. As the shoes wear down, the adjuster moves them closer to the drum to maintain optimal clearance and ensure consistent braking performance. Most modern drum brake assemblies have an automatic adjuster that self-adjusts each time the brakes are applied.

2. Labor Costs Labor charges can vary widely depending on your location and the repair shop you choose. On average, labor costs for brake work can range from $75 to $150 per hour. The replacement of rear brake drums typically requires about 1.5 to 2 hours of labor, making the labor cost anywhere between $100 and $300.
